>>WHY JATROPHA…?
>>Jatropha is thus unique among renewable energy
>>sources in terms of the potential benefits that can be
>>expected to result from its widespread use. Its
>>cultivation is technologically simple and requires
>>comparatively low capital investment. The large-scale
>>cultivation of Jatropha should target the 296 million
>>hectares of strongly degraded land that requires
>>treatment before food production is possible on them
>>again. Once the Jatropha trees establish themselves
>>and fertilize the soil, their shade can be used for
>>intercropping shade-loving medicinal plants, vanila,
>>vegetables such as red and green peppers, tomatoes
>>etc. that would provide additional income for the
>>farmers. Benefits from its large scale cultivation, in
>>addition to the various positive effects on a
>>macro-level, will accrue to a large extent to marginal
>>land holders in many tropical countries, who despite
>>being hapless victims of the vagaries of climate are
>>the least organised and hence least favouredThe
>>jatropha plantation creates a positive correlation
>>between energy production and food production. It
>>promotes main aspects of development whick combine to
>>help assure a sustainable way of life for rural kishan
>>and the soil that supports them.
